Available capacities range from small to very large: 4 oz, 8 oz, 1 pint (16 oz), 1 quart (32 oz), and larger pantry options at about 47 oz, 75 oz, and 138 oz.

Small jars work best for single servings and small batches: 4‑ounce jars are ideal for single portions or gifts, while 8‑ounce jars suit slightly larger small-batch quantities.

Design options include clear glass for a classic look, quilted/crystal decorative patterns for smaller jars, and pantry-style clear canisters often topped with knob-style lid handles—all suitable for gifting or countertop display.

Common sizes used for canning and preserving include 4 oz, 8 oz, 16 oz (1 pint), and 32 oz (1 quart), which cover single servings up through standard preserving batches.

Many glass mason jar sets are sold in 12‑piece packs. The plastic food storage canister and some pantry jars are typically sold as single items.
